01 logo

Mastering the Art of Web Development

Become a Web Developer: A Step-by-Step Guide

By Loganathan N PPublished 3 years ago 3 min read
Web development

What is Web Development?

Web development is the practice of creating and maintaining websites. It involves a range of tasks, including designing the layout and appearance of a website, writing the code that makes it function, and setting up servers to host the site.

Web development can be done using a variety of programming languages and involves both front-end (user-facing) and back-end (server-side) development. It is an important field that plays a vital role in today's digital world, as almost every business and organization has a website.

How to become a Web Developer?

To become a web developer, it is important to have a strong foundation in a variety of topics. Some of the key areas that you should consider learning include:

  1. HTML (HyperText Markup Language) - the standard markup language for creating web pages
  2. CSS (Cascading Style Sheets) - a stylesheet language used for describing the look and formatting of a document written in HTML
  3. JavaScript - a programming language that allows for the creation of interactive web pages
  4. Responsive design - the practice of designing and building websites that work well on a variety of devices and screen sizes
  5. Accessibility - the practice of making websites usable by people with disabilities
  6. Security - measures taken to protect websites and their users from malicious attacks
  7. Database management - the process of storing, organizing, and managing data using a database
  8. Server-side programming - the creation of server-side scripts and applications to power the back-end of a website
  9. Version control - the management of changes to source code and other files related to a project

There are many other topics that are important to web development, and the specific topics that are most important may vary depending on the specific goals and needs of a project. Some other examples of important topics in web development include:

  • User experience (UX) design
  • Search engine optimization (SEO)
  • Content management systems (CMS)
  • E-commerce development
  • Web application development
  • Mobile web development
  • Cloud computing
  • Data visualization
  • Artificial intelligence (AI) and machine learning
  • Virtual and augmented reality (VR/AR)

Web development is a constantly evolving field, and it is important for web developers to stay up-to-date with the latest technologies and best practices.

What does a web developer do?

A web developer is responsible for building and maintaining websites. Their job duties may include:

  • Designing and building the layout, appearance, and functionality of a website.
  • Writing, testing, and debugging code using programming languages such as HTML, CSS, and JavaScript.
  • Setting up and configuring servers to host a website.
  • Integrating a website with databases and back-end systems.
  • Ensuring that a website is optimized for search engines and that it is accessible to users with disabilities.
  • Collaborating with designers, project managers, and other team members to plan and build new features and functionality for a website.
  • Troubleshooting and debugging issues that arise with a website.
  • Staying up-to-date with the latest web development technologies and best practices.

Web developers may work on the front-end, which refers to the part of the website that users interact with, or the back-end, which refers to the underlying systems that make the website work. They may also work on both the front-end and back-end of a website, depending on the project’s specific needs.

Roadmap to become a successful web developer:

Here is a simple, high-level roadmap that you can follow to become a web developer:

  • Learn the fundamental technologies of the web: HTML, CSS, and JavaScript.
  • Build your own websites and experiment with modifying existing ones.
  • Learn additional programming languages, such as PHP or Python, if needed.
  • Learn about databases, server-side development, and web security.
  • Learn about user experience (UX) design and make user-centered design a focus in your projects.
  • Stay up-to-date with the latest technologies and best practices in web development.
  • Gain hands-on experience through internships, projects, or freelance work.

Remember that becoming a web developer is a journey, and it may take some time to learn all of the necessary skills. It is important to be patient, stay focused, and keep practicing in order to become a successful web developer.

Conclusion:

In conclusion, web development is a vital and constantly evolving field that plays a crucial role in today's digital world.

In order to become a successful web developer, it is important to have a solid understanding of the fundamentals, continually learn and stay up-to-date with new technologies and best practices, and gain hands-on experience through projects and real-world work.

how to

About the Creator

Loganathan N P

Hi, this is Loganathan N P, a software developer who has a high level of ambition.

Reader insights

Be the first to share your insights about this piece.

How does it work?

Add your insights

Comments

There are no comments for this story

Be the first to respond and start the conversation.

Sign in to comment

    Find us on social media

    Miscellaneous links

    • Explore
    • Contact
    • Privacy Policy
    • Terms of Use
    • Support

    © 2026 Creatd, Inc. All Rights Reserved.